New Guidelines Urge Early Action on High Blood Pressure to Prevent Heart Disease
Updated AHA/ACC guidelines recommend early treatment and lifestyle changes to manage high blood pressure, reducing risks of heart disease, stroke, and cognitive decline.
High blood pressure is a major risk factor for heart disease, stroke, kidney disease, and cognitive decline, affecting nearly half of all adults in the U.S. The updated guidelines from leading health organizations provide a roadmap for early detection, prevention, and management, offering hope for reducing the prevalence and impact of these conditions. By adopting the recommended lifestyle changes and treatment strategies, individuals can significantly lower their risk of serious health complications, underscoring the importance of these guidelines for public health.
